The Chicago Bears have officially ended their playoff drought.
After four years without postseason action, Caleb Williams and his team are set to face Jordan Love’s Green Bay Packers in a wild-card matchup on Saturday, January 10th at Soldier Field.
It’s quite an achievement for a team that wrapped up the 2024 season at the bottom of the NFC North with a record of 5 wins and 12 losses.

The Bears and Packers faced each other twice during the 2025 regular season. In the first game on December 7, Green Bay claimed victory with a 28-21 score after leading at halftime.
In their second encounter on December 20, Chicago staged a comeback, winning 22-16 in overtime thanks to a pivotal touchdown pass from Caleb Williams to DJ Moore.
Yet, despite their 11-6 record, the Windy City team isn’t resting on their laurels. Johnson mentioned post-game, “It’s a tough opponent. I think we’re pretty evenly matched. I respect their talent and coaching. It’s bound to be an exciting game.”
Both teams come into this much-anticipated matchup with some losses to process. The Packers, with a record of 9-7, were knocked out of the playoffs, while the Bears faltered in their last two games against the 49ers and Lions.

About the Bears vs. Packers Matchup
In a storied rivalry dating back to 1921, the Packers currently hold a slight edge with 109 wins to the Bears’ 97, plus 6 ties.
As noted, they split the season series in 2025.
But, as always, the playoffs bring a fresh start.
ESPN’s Matt Bowen thinks “the Bears have an excellent shot,” but he emphasizes the need for them to maintain balance and leverage play-action plays for Caleb Williams.”
